## Formula sandbox tuning

User-supplied formulas in Gridmoor execute inside a restricted interpreter with hard ceilings on time, memory, and call depth. Reviewers should confirm any change to these ceilings is justified in the PR description, since raising them widens the abuse surface. Defaults were chosen from production traces. The current limits are as follows.

limits module of tafog-fawip:
WEIGHTS = {
    "julix": 57,
    "lamys": 992,
    "kasvan": 209,
    "quenok": 750,
    "alddor": 259,
    "oliath": 1009,
    "wenix": 815,
}

**Handover: Orchidly GraphQL N+1 fix**

Welcome aboard. Before I roll off, a summary: the feed resolver on Orchidly was issuing one query per comment author, which tanked under load. I replaced it with the batch loader in the dataplane package; it coalesces lookups within a 10ms window. Tests live next to the resolver. Tuning is all environment-driven, so nothing is hardcoded. The current loader settings in production are shown below.

service settings:
[silwyn]
host = silwyn.crelvogrid.internal
user = silwyn_svc
database = silwyn_prod

Action item PM-7 (Harrowgate outage). Flaky DNS resolution in the Covey fleet stemmed from resolver timeouts shorter than the upstream's p99 under load, causing spurious failovers and cache stampedes. Fix: raise the timeout, add jittered retries, and pin a minimum TTL so negative caching stops amplifying blips. Owner: infra rotation; due before the next Covey release cut. Release manager should block promotion until canary DNS error rate is flat for 24h under these settings:

tuning table, faduf-baduf:
PRIORITIES = {
    "ulavan": 191,
    "silys": 750,
    "goriel": 238,
    "kelmir": 66,
    "wendor": 432,
}